Manufacturing
Engineer III/IV
Support
systems assembly in a dynamic ISO manufacturing environment. Responsibilities
will include providing assistance in planning, development, implementation
and maintenance of manufacturing processes (hardware, software and documentation).
Provide technical expertise with root cause failure analysis, review
engineering change order and provide assistance in activities involving
new product introductions. Must be fluent with shop floor systems and
provide training to the organization. Capacity modeling and space planning
experience necessary. Proven capability to implement Lean Manufacturing
philosophies in a high mix/low volume environment. Mentor and provide
direction to the junior level engineering community and operations.
Must have excellent
verbal and written communications skills. 2+ years experience working
within an ISO manufacturing environment. 5+ years engineering experience
in a manufacturing environment. 3+ years experience as a senior level
or equivalent engineer. BSME, BSIE, or equivalent experience.

Senior
Human Resources Generalist
Responsible
for managing the day-to-day Human Resources needs within the organization
including but not limited to: recruitment, benefits administration,
employee relations, training, safety and other projects as assigned.
Assist in designing and administering Human Resources guidelines. Assure
compliance with EEO regulations, Labor Laws and OSHA requirements. Administer
benefits to include medical, 401K, WC, STD/LTD and FMLA. Facilitate
new hire orientation and process paperwork prescribed by law and internal
processes. Coordinate and/or facilitate internal training programs.
Assist in implementing and maintaining compensation review process.
Manage recruitment for a variety of positions. Coordinate the year-end
performance review process, ensuring consistency across the organization.
Lead and direct the company safety committee ensuring focus and attention
addresses OSHA requirements and internal safety concerns.
A minimum
of 5 years progressively responsible HR generalist experience. Good
working knowledge of ER, Federal and State regulations, recognition
and reward systems and employment practices. Proven ability to effectively
apply HR programs and practices to a dynamic organization. Creative
thinker and planner who can generate new ideas and approaches. Excellent
communication skills, both verbal and written. Leadership, team orientation
and flexibility are also essential. Must be able to manage multiple
priorities and work autonomously with minimal supervision. BA degree
or equivalent work experience required.
